About 13 Elsicker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

13 Elsicker Lane is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Warmfield, Wakefield, Wakefield (WF1 5TW). It has a recorded floor area of 56 m² (around 603 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(July 2025)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since August 2014.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good; while window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 75).

At 56 m² it sits well below the postcode median (101 m² across 26 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. 10 years since the last transfer (May 2016). Across 2003–2016,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£162,000 is 47.9% above the 2016 sale price.
